The story of this activity starts at the beginning of 1966, when Mr. Pranzini, the pioneer of the firm, carries out his first concrete handmanufactured implements for gardens, inside a small area in the suburbs of Bologna.
Then, in 1969, with the entry of a new member, Mr. Gherardini, the firm assumes a new social order known as P.A.G..
By this new force, the company grows up and develops its own activity until, in 1982, with the acquisition of a new, larger, industrial area at Castelluccio, a small fraction of Porretta Terme, the new seat is definitively fixed, for the production on a vast scale of a wide range of garden furniture, manufactured in reinforced concrete in imitation of coarse-featured wood. |
